Navicat导入Excel教程详解,操作步骤有哪些疑问?
**1、Navicat支持通过导入向导将Excel文件高效导入数据库;2、简道云零代码开发平台为企业提供了更便捷的数据管理和可视化工具;3、结合二者可以极大提升数据处理效率。**在实际操作中,使用Navicat的“导入向导”功能,可以一步步选择Excel文件、对应表结构以及字段映射,实现批量数据精准入库。例如,将销售数据从Excel表格批量导入MySQL数据库时,只需按步骤上传文件、设置映射关系并确认即可,大大减少了人工录入和出错概率。同时,通过简道云零代码开发平台(官网地址),企业还能将这些数据快速构建成自动化工作流,实现业务在线化管理与分析,进一步提升效率。
《navicat导入excel》
一、NAVICAT 导入 EXCEL 的核心流程与优势
Navicat是一款知名的数据库管理工具,广泛支持MySQL、MariaDB、SQL Server等主流数据库。其“导入向导”功能,支持从多种格式(如Excel .xls/.xlsx, CSV, TXT等)快速批量将数据写入指定数据库表。此功能对于日常需要大量处理结构化表格数据的用户而言极为实用,极大提升了工作效率。
| 步骤 | 详细说明 |
|---|---|
| 1. 打开目标数据库 | 在Navicat中连接并选择需导入数据的数据库及目标表 |
| 2. 启动导入向导 | 右键目标表或空白处,选择“导入向导”->“从文件” |
| 3. 选择 Excel 文件 | 浏览本地磁盘,选取待上传的 .xls 或 .xlsx 文件 |
| 4. 字段匹配 | 系统自动识别字段,可手动调整源文件与目标表字段的映射关系 |
| 5. 配置参数 | 设置如跳过首行(标题)、编码格式、日期格式等相关选项 |
| 6. 执行与校验 | 一键执行后可预览结果并校验是否正确写入,有错误可回退修正 |
优势:
- 支持大批量、高并发、多格式的数据处理;
- 操作简单直观,无需复杂编码,仅需基础IT知识即可完成;
- 自动字段映射及类型转换,有效减少人工失误。
二、NAVICAT 导入 EXCEL 常见问题及应对方案
在实际应用过程中,经常会遇到如下问题:
- 字段类型不匹配:如Excel中的文本列被识别为数字型导致写库失败。
- 数据重复/主键冲突:Excel中存在重复记录,与数据库唯一约束冲突。
- 编码异常/乱码:中文字符未正确识别导致乱码。
- 日期时间格式错乱:Excel日期无法直接转换为SQL标准时间戳。
应对方法列表:
| 问题类型 | 应对措施 |
|---|---|
| 字段类型不匹配 | 导前检查目标库字段定义,并在映射阶段手动调整对应关系 |
| 数据重复 | 利用Navicat内置去重选项或先用Excel筛选去重 |
| 编码异常 | 确保EXCEL保存为UTF-8格式,并在向导参数中指定正确编码 |
| 日期时间错乱 | 在EXCEL内统一日期格式,或在Navicat中设置自定义解析规则 |
特别提醒:建议先在测试环境进行小规模试验,再批量操作生产库,以防不可逆错误。
三、结合简道云零代码开发平台实现更高效的数据管理
随着企业对业务流程数字化要求提高,仅靠传统桌面软件已难以满足灵活多变的数据流转需求。简道云零代码开发平台(点击访问官网)为用户提供了如下创新能力:
- 无需编程即可搭建各类业务系统——包括CRM、人事管理、项目协作等;
- 强大的数据采集与展示能力——支持多端填写、自定义报表和权限管控;
- 自由集成外部系统/数据库——同步ERP/财务/OA等多源异构数据;
- 自动化工作流引擎驱动业务流转——实现审批流、自定义提醒和自动任务分配。
例如,当企业通过Navicat成功把历史EXCEL销售记录批量写进MySQL后,可以利用简道云实时同步这些数据,一键生成销售报表仪表盘,还能设置业绩达标自动推送奖励通知,大幅度降低IT投入和运营成本。
应用场景举例:
- 财务部门每月将银行流水EXCEL明细通过Navicat统一归档至财务库→简道云实时分析资金流状况并触发预算预警;
- 售后客服汇总客户反馈EXCEL→一键写库→简道云派单至对应区域工程师APP端,提高响应速度与客户满意度。
四、NAVICAT 与 简道云结合带来的协同价值
两者结合具有以下显著优势:
- 数据采集多样性
- Navicat适合历史大批量离线结构化数据注库;
- 简道云适合在线动态实时采集、多终端协同上报。
- 数据治理全周期覆盖
- 从原始采集→清洗加工→权限控制→统计分析,全流程无缝衔接。
- 降低技术门槛
- 普通员工通过零代码界面即可参与业务系统建设,无需专业开发背景。
- 灵活扩展性
- 支持API/Webhook/定时任务接力,实现跨部门系统互通有无。
下列表格具体对比二者整合后的工作模式:
| 环节 | 原有方式 | 整合后方式 |
|---|---|---|
| 历史资料归档 | 人工整理EXCEL上传 | Navicat一键批量注库 |
| 新增业务流程搭建 | IT人员开发定制系统 | 简道云拖拉拽搭建应用 |
| 跨部门协作 | 邮件/QQ群手工传递 | 简道云在线共享+权限分级管控 |
| 数据分析报表 | 手动筛选透视 | 可视化仪表盘拖拽生成,自定义维度切换 |
五、高效实施NAVICAT EXCEL 导入项目实践指南
要保证项目成功落地,应遵循如下最佳实践步骤:
- 数据预处理
- 用EXCEL先清理空值、多余列、统一格式;
- 尤其注意编号唯一性及主外键关系合法性;
- 建立标准模板
- 企业可制定统一上报模板(如客户信息登记),利于后续多年累计归档;
- 分步验证
- 每次只做少量样本测试,通过再全量投产;
- 权限管控
- 明确谁有权操作DB谁仅读、防止误删误改;
- 自动备份
- 注库前建议定期快照备份重要业务DB,以防万一;
- 后续运维联动
- 注库成功即同步至简道云,让各部门随时查阅或触发下一环节自动处理;
详细步骤如下列表所示:
| 步骤序号 | 操作内容 | 工具说明 |
|---|---|---|
| 1 | EXCEL清洗标准模板 | Office/金山WPS等 |
| 2 | Navicat连接目标数据库 | Navicat for MySQL等 |
| 3 | 启动“导入向导”,逐步配置参数 | Navicat |
| 4 | 映射字段/校验一致性 | Navicat |
| 5 | 执行并检查注库结果 | Navicat |
| 6 | 数据同步到简道云自动化工作流 | 简道云零代码平台 |
六、小结与行动建议
综上所述,通过充分利用Navicat高效安全地完成EXCEL到各类主流关系型数据库的数据注入,不仅能解决传统人工录单易出错的问题,更能借助现代零代码开发平台——如简道云,实现企业级多人协同、一体式自动化运营管理。在实际部署时,应着重做好原始资料预处理、安全备份及分步验证,同时充分发挥工具间联动能力,让IT赋能成为推动业务创新升级的重要利器。 强烈建议各类中大型企事业单位根据自身数字化水平,积极尝试上述方案。如需进一步体验丰富行业模板,可访问:100+企业管理系统模板免费使用>>>无需下载,在线安装。这将帮助您的团队快速搭建适应个性需求的信息化系统,实现降本增效及持续创新!
精品问答:
Navicat导入Excel时,如何确保数据格式正确避免导入失败?
我在使用Navicat导入Excel文件时,总是遇到数据格式不匹配导致导入失败的问题。想知道有哪些方法可以确保Excel中的数据格式与数据库字段类型一致,避免出错?
为了确保Navicat导入Excel时数据格式正确,可以采取以下措施:
- 预先校验Excel数据格式:确保日期、数字、文本等列的格式与目标数据库字段类型一致。
- 使用Navicat的数据类型映射功能:在导入向导中设置每列对应的数据库字段类型。
- 清理空白或异常值:删除Excel中的空行和无效数据,避免插入错误。 案例说明:如果数据库中某字段为DATE类型,而Excel中该列包含非日期文本,则会导致导入失败。提前转换或修正该列格式即可有效避免此类问题。根据官方统计,正确的数据类型映射可以提升90%以上的导入成功率。
Navicat如何批量高效地从Excel导入大量数据?
我有一个超过10万条记录的Excel文件需要导入到MySQL数据库中,用Navicat能否高效完成批量导入?有没有推荐的步骤和技巧提高效率?
Navicat支持批量高效导入大规模Excel数据,建议采用以下步骤:
| 步骤 | 说明 |
|---|---|
| 数据预处理 | 清理重复和脏数据,保证质量 |
| 分批拆分 | 将大文件拆分为多个小文件(如每1万条) |
| 使用‘表设计’同步结构 | 确保表结构与Excel列完全匹配 |
| 导入向导配置 | 勾选“跳过已存在记录”等选项优化性能 |
案例说明:某企业通过拆分10万行Excel为10个1万行文件,结合Navicat的多线程支持,将总耗时缩短至30分钟以内,比单次直接导入节省了70%时间。
使用Navicat从Excel导入后,如何检查并修复重复数据?
我用Navicat从Excel成功导入了大量数据,但担心有重复记录影响数据库质量,有什么方法能快速找出并处理重复数据吗?
检查及修复重复数据的常用方法包括:
- 利用SQL查询筛选重复行:
SELECT column_name, COUNT(*) as count FROM table_name GROUP BY column_name HAVING count > 1;- 使用Navicat自带的数据同步及去重工具。
- 创建唯一索引防止未来插入重复。
案例说明:在电商客户表中,通过以上SQL语句找到5%的客户信息重复,通过删除冗余并建立唯一索引后,系统查询速度提升25%。
Navicat支持哪些Excel文件格式进行数据导入?是否有限制?
我手头有不同版本和扩展名的Excel文件,不确定它们是否都能通过Navicat顺利导入。哪些具体的文件格式被支持,有没有大小或版本限制?
Navicat主要支持以下几种Excel文件格式进行直接导入:
.xls(Microsoft Excel 97-2003).xlsx(Microsoft Excel 2007及以上).csv(逗号分隔值)也常用于变通处理
限制方面:
- 文件大小通常建议不超过100MB,否则可能出现性能瓶颈。
- 某些复杂公式或宏无法解析,仅支持纯表格内容。
根据官方文档及用户反馈,.xlsx是最推荐且兼容性最高的格式,占据70%以上用户首选。对于超过100MB的大型文件,可以先转换为CSV再分批上传以提高效率。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/75053/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。